Workers Memorial Day in Melbourne

Thursday 28 April 2011
MOURNING THE DEAD AND FIGHTING FOR THE LIVING
At the Remembrance Rock
Corner Victoria and Lygon Streets
Carlton South

The ceremony will commence at 10.30am
Speakers include:
Brian Boyd, VTHC Secretary
Deanne May, Executive Director IDSA
Judge Jennifer Coate, State Coroner of Victoria

The ICFTU has announced the international theme for 2011 is the crucial role played by trade unions, strong regulation and effective enforcement in securing safer workplaces. This theme is particularly relevant given Australia is currently in the process of harmonising our OHS legislation. Victorian union movement will continue to fight for the best model law for all workers.

IDSA will be hosting morning tea following the event in Meeting Rm 1 (entry from Victoria St)

Workers Memorial Day is organised by the Victorian Trades Hall Council in conjunction with Industrial Deaths and Advocacy Inc (IDSA) Work to live; not to die.
